Originally Posted by Norene B
They also have things in the assisted living section like magnifying lights that hook to a table, bath safety grip handle that might work to hold rulers, etc.
I use the bath safety handle for the same purpose others use the quilt handle gripper. I got one on sale at Bed, Bath & Beyond, plus a 20% off coupon. Turned out to be much cheaper and works exactly the same. In fact I believe it IS the same thing, just labeled different for quilters. And marked UP for quilters.

Suction cup handles are used on the rulers to hold them in place while you cut. Mine is oraginally a bathtub safety handle but when I saw it used in a picture on this board I have used one for the ruler. It is wonderful. Keeps fingers out of the way of the cutters and keeps the ruler from slipping.
